Sustainability of Digital Formats: Planning for Library of Congress Collections

Introduction | Sustainability Factors | Content Categories | Format Descriptions | Contact
Format Description Categories >> Browse Alphabetical List

Logic Pro Project Format

>> Back
Table of Contents
Format Description Properties Explanation of format description terms

Identification and description Explanation of format description terms

Full name Logic Pro Project Format
Description

According to Apple Inc., the creator and maintainer of the proprietary Logic Pro digital audio workstations application, "a Logic Pro project package format saves all the project’s assets, including the project’s audio files, within a single file, and has a .logicx file extension." Project assets can include audio and video files (including MIDI data), samples for the Sampler or Ultrabeat, and Space Designer reverb impulse response files, edits and loops, plugin settings and other assets. Manage project assets in Logic Pro for Mac from Logic Pro User Guide for Mac 11.1 notes that "saving projects without assets can save disk space, but as a result, the project can’t access the referenced files when moved, unless the assets are also moved...MIDI data from software instrument recordings, added loops or MIDI files, and parameter settings for the channel strips and plug-ins are always saved as part of a project." FileInfo.com states that "when Logic Pro X was released in 2013, the LOGICX file replaced the .LOGIC file, which was used by Logic Pro 9 and earlier. Logic Pro X can open LOGIC files that were created by Logic Pro 5, 6, 7, 8, and 9." The LOGICX package is required to round trip Logic Pro projects between Mac and iPad. Projects created in Logic Pro for iPad are automatically saved as LOGICX packages.

Logic Pro software offers two ways to save projects: as a project package or project folder. Logic Pro User Guide for Mac v. 11.1 (p. 142) describes the difference: "Project package: Project assets are copied to the project package, or are referenced from another location, depending on which asset types are selected in the Save dialog. By default, the converted project is saved inside the existing project folder, if one exists. Project folder: Project assets are copied to the appropriate subfolders of the project folder, or are referenced from another location, depending on which asset types are selected in the Save dialog. By default, the existing project folder and subfolders are used, if present, and any additional subfolders needed for project assets are created." The simple answer re package vs folder discussion on the Apple Community Forum (2017) summarizes it as "use a package if you plan to exchange a lot of projects with a collaborator; use a folder if you mainly keep things on your own computer... A package is a folder, with the only difference that the Finder "sees" a package as one file; you can access the files within a package only via a contextual menu (control- or rightclick on it). But were you to save a project both as package and as a folder, they would contain the same files and be of the exact same size." LOGICX are package files (not project folders) used to bring all the assets together into one entity for sharing between collaborators and systems. The Logic Pro project file entry on archiveteam.org explains that "LOGICX files are actually folders in the Apple Bundle/Package format" (which is formally described in the Apple Developer Bundle Programming Guide. Common packages: documents which are folders in drag states that "packages are one of the Finder’s grand illusions. They’re actually folders containing more folders and files, which are presented to the user as if they were actually a single item, just like a file." Despite Apple's own language which describes this format class as a "file," it isn't really a file in the traditional sense because there is no discrete method to identify them as such other than that extension is simply registered with the MacOS to know they should appear as a file. Comments welcome. Tyler Thorsted's 2023 blog post Apple Package Format describes some of the evolution of this format class, including the GarageBand project package which can also be opened in Logic Pro software. For more information about packages and bundles in Mac systems, see Bundle, package, library, or folder?.

On Reddit's Package or Folder? thread (started in 2021) some users report that while LOGICX packages are preferable when "bouncing" or rendering a project to single audio file or to multiple audio files, they can also be problematic "When working in folders, Logic defaults to bouncing a song in that project’s ‘bounces’, where as when working with packages Logic will bounce to the last location in which a song was bounced" which can be challenging to locate.

The structure of a LOGICX file is detailed in How to Open a Corrupted Logic Project. "Starting with Logic Pro X, a Project File is now a Package File type (sometimes also referred to as a Bundle). It looks like a regular file, but it is basically a folder in disguise. ... Logic organizes those files in a specific way and relies on that structure." The top level is the project file with the .logicx extension and within that file are three subfolders:

  • Alternatives: alternative versions of a project, each with a unique name and different settings. Project alternatives let you save “snapshots” of a project in different states, including different cuts or mixes. They’re saved as part of the project and share the same assets. For more information about alternatives, see Use project alternatives and backups in Logic Pro for Mac. Within the Alternatives folder are subfolders which represent each Alternative in its own separate folders, named sequentially "000" (the default Project), "001", 002" and on as needed.
  • Media: includes subfolders of video and audio data such as WAV files and other media data. This folder may be absent if the media is not stored with the project.
  • Resources: includes content such as playlists (.plst), music notation, accompanying images (.jpeg) and more.

For sample LOGICX packages, see https://github.com/PacktPublishing/Jumpstart-Logic-Pro-10.6.

Production phase Used for content in initial (by content creators) and middle (by archives) state.
Relationship to other formats
    May have component WAVE, WAVE Audio File Format. As of 2025, Logic Pro natively supports import of WAVE Audio File Format audio data and this format may be included in the Log Pro Session Package. See Supported file formats in Logic Pro for iPad. Note that the title of this page specifies iPad but the text does not seem to indicate the information is limited only to Logic Pro for iPad. Comments welcome.
    May have component AIFF, AIFF (Audio Interchange File Format). Logic Pro natively supports import of AIFF File Format audio data and this format may be included in the Log Pro Session Package. See Supported file formats in Logic Pro for iPad. Note that the title of this page specifies iPad but the text does not seem to indicate the information is limited only to Logic Pro for iPad. Comments welcome.
    May have component CAF, Apple Core Audio Format. Logic Pro natively supports import of CAF audio data and this format may be included in the Log Pro Session Package. See Supported file formats in Logic Pro for iPad. Note that the title of this page specifies iPad but the text does not seem to indicate the information is limited only to Logic Pro for iPad. Comments welcome.
    May have component MP3_ENC, MP3 (MPEG Layer III Audio Encoding). Logic Pro natively supports import of MP3 audio data and this format may be included in the Log Pro Session Package. See Supported file formats in Logic Pro for iPad. Note that the title of this page specifies iPad but the text does not seem to indicate the information is limited only to Logic Pro for iPad. Comments welcome.
    May have component SMF, Standard MIDI File Format. Logic Pro natively supports import of MIDI data and this format may be included in the Log Pro Session Package. See Supported file formats in Logic Pro for iPad. Note that the title of this page specifies iPad but the text does not seem to indicate the information is limited only to Logic Pro for iPad. Comments welcome.
    May have component Other file types not separately described can be included within the Logic Pro Project.

Local use Explanation of format description terms

LC experience or existing holdings The Library of Congress has a small number of Logic Pro project files in its collections, especially in the Music Division.
LC preference See the Library of Congress Recommended Formats Statement (RFS) for preferences for audio content.

Sustainability factors Explanation of format description terms

Disclosure Poor. Propriety format from Apple. Comments welcome.
    Documentation No practical file format information is available from Apple or elsewhere. A 2020 forum discussion thread on Logic Pro Help titled Internal Logic Pro X file format docs? laments the lack of official documentation and includes summaries of attempts at reversed engineered explorations. Comments welcome.
Adoption The Production Experts 2024 DAW User Survey - The Results (Aug 13, 2024) reports that the Logic Pro application (and thereby users of Logic Pro project files) shows a slight increase in popularity among music users, placing it as one of the most widely used Digital Audio Workstations (DAWs) with approximately 13.35% of the DAW market share in 2023 and 13.39% in 2024 (behind Avid Pro Tools). Who uses Logic Pro DAW? (2021) states that many well-known artists including Calvin Harris, Ed Sheeran, David Guetta as well as Billie Eilish and Finneas O'Connell are Logic Pro users.
    Licensing and patents Unknown for the file format but this is a proprietary format owned by Apple Inc. and there is a license agreement for the Logic Pro application as well as several patents as of 2019.
Transparency Requires Logic Pro software to read and write.
Self-documentation

Unknown since no public documentation about format structure. Comments welcome.

Accessibility Features

Logic Pro project files have no identified specific features to support accessibility. The Logic Pro application does have Accessibility settings in Logic Pro for Mac that can be enabled and there is a forum discussion from 2017 about these features and their implementation and, in some cases, shortcomings. The Columbia University Teachers College Digital Futures Institute: Logic Pro X entry states that "Logic Pro X meets most of Teacher College’s accessibility criteria. It allows for navigation via assistive technology and customization of visual appearance and layout." See also supported file types in Relationships. Comments welcome.

External dependencies LOGICX files files are viable only within Logic Pro software.
Technical protection considerations None. Pro Tools has no native capacity for file encryption in session files or other components. Comments welcome.

Quality and functionality factors Explanation of format description terms

Sound
Normal rendering This format does not render sound.
Functionality beyond normal rendering This format does not render sound but instead encapsulates project files, including audio data, together for collaboration and transport.

File type signifiers and format identifiers Explanation of format description terms

Tag Value Note
Filename extension logicx
Used for Logic Pro X and later editions. See Apple Support: Work on a Logic Pro project on your iPad and your Mac.
Filename extension logic
Used by Logic Pro 9 and earlier. See FileInfo.com: .LOGICX File Extension.
Other See note.  NARA File Format Preservation Plan ID has no corresponding entry as of January 2025.
Pronom PUID See note.  PRONOM has no corresponding entry as of January 2025.
Wikidata Title ID Q105861649
See https://www.wikidata.org/wiki/Q105861649 for Logic Pro X project (file format)

Notes Explanation of format description terms

General

While lower case for file extensions is typical, a support update for Logic Pro for iPad 2.0.1 notes that "Song files with an uppercase .LOGICX file extension now load as expected" which hints that uppercase file names were problematic before this fix. Comments welcome.

History See A Brief History Of Logic, From Emagic To Apple for history of Logic Pro application but does not contain information about Logic Pro file formats. Wikipedia Logic Pro also has a summary of the application.

Format specifications Explanation of format description terms


Useful references

URLs


Last Updated: 02/04/2025